Catalog description

Introduction to media theory by way of some of its key texts and themes, with particular emphasis on how questions of medium, media, and mass media might be useful to literary studies in particular - that is, the study of predominantly textual artifacts. Works by Innis, McLuhan, Derrida, Adorno, Kittler, Hayles, Flusser and others.
